3 Things Entry Level Job Candidates Can Do to Stand Out

The entry-level job market for software developers has drastically changed. Gone are the days when a computer science degree almost guaranteed a lucrative job offer, sometimes even months before graduation. In today’s highly competitive market, distinguishing yourself from other candidates is more essential than ever. As a hiring manager, here are three key strategies I’ve seen successful candidates use to stand out.

1. Sharpen your soft skills, because they’re more important than ever.

Artificial intelligence (AI) is becoming increasingly capable of performing technical tasks, and this makes human soft skills more valuable than ever. Your professional worth is progressively tied to your ability to communicate effectively and think strategically. Employers want candidates who can clearly articulate their thoughts, work collaboratively, and understand how their technical contributions align with broader business objectives. Highlighting your teamwork experience, ability to solve complex problems with others, and examples of clear communication can significantly differentiate you from other entry-level applicants.

Soft skills are more than just interpersonal interactions. They include empathy, adaptability, conflict resolution, and emotional intelligence. Employers value candidates who demonstrate maturity in navigating difficult conversations, understanding diverse perspectives, and contributing positively to team culture.

2. Prepare targeted questions for your interviewer.

During interviews, candidates often overlook the opportunity to make an impression by asking insightful questions. Instead of generic things like, “What does a typical day look like?” or “Why do you like working here?”, prepare specific, targeted questions that show you’ve done your research. For example, you might say, “I read your values page, and ‘Own It’ really resonates with me. In my class projects, I’ve always felt deeply responsible for writing clean, effective code. Can you share a recent example of how that value has impacted your work?”

Preparing three to five thoughtful questions for every conversation ensures you won’t miss an opportunity to engage deeply and demonstrate genuine interest in the organization and role.

3. Demonstrate your curiosity and passion.

Showing curiosity goes beyond expressing general enthusiasm; it involves demonstrating active engagement with the field. Share your thoughts on industry trends, interesting articles you’ve recently read, emerging technologies you’re exploring, or new tools you’ve discovered and found helpful. For example, discussing your experience with a new JavaScript framework or your opinions about the implications of generative AI in software development illustrates your passion and commitment to continuous learning.

Hiring managers value candidates who show they’re actively participating in their own growth, not passively waiting for knowledge to come to them.

Standing out in today’s competitive entry-level job market requires more than technical skills alone. By focusing on soft skills, preparing thoughtful and targeted questions, and demonstrating genuine curiosity, candidates can significantly increase their chances of securing a meaningful opportunity.

Conversation

Join the conversation

Your email address will not be published. Required fields are marked *